Sony Vaio Tap 11 is a bit better than the Honor MagicPad 2 12.3, getting a global score of 66 against 61.1. Despite being the best in this review, the Sony Vaio Tap 11 is a extremely thicker and a lot heavier tablet device than the Honor MagicPad 2 12.3. The Sony Vaio Tap 11 works with Windows 8 OS, while Honor MagicPad 2 12.3 has Android 14 OS.
Honor MagicPad 2 12.3 counts with a sharper screen than Sony Vaio Tap 11, because it has a much better 1920 x 3000 resolution, a way higher screen pixel density and a bit larger screen. The Sony Vaio Tap 11 features a very superior hardware performance than Honor MagicPad 2 12.3, because although it has lesser RAM, it also counts with a higher number of cores.
Honor MagicPad 2 12.3 takes a lot better videos and photos than Sony Vaio Tap 11, because it has a camera with much more MP. Honor MagicPad 2 12.3 counts with much more storage for games and applications than Sony Vaio Tap 11, because although it has no slot for external memory cards, it also counts with more internal memory.
Honor MagicPad 2 12.3 counts with a really longer battery life than Sony Vaio Tap 11, because it has a 164 percent larger battery size.
The Sony Vaio Tap 11 is more expensive than the Honor MagicPad 2 12.3, but you can get a better tablet for that few extra dollars.
